An equalizer is an audio device that allows users to adjust the frequency response of an audio system. It allows users to fine-tune the bass, treble, and other aspects of the sound to create a more personalized listening experience. Bluetooth party speakers with equalizer have become increasingly popular due to the many benefits they offer. Here are some of the benefits of having an equalizer in a Bluetooth party speaker:
1. Customizable sound: One of the primary benefits of having an equalizer in a Bluetooth party speaker is the ability to customize the sound output to your liking. Different genres of music require different sound settings, and the equalizer allows you to adjust the bass, treble, and other aspects of the sound to match the specific genre of music you are listening to. This creates a more personalized listening experience and enhances the overall sound quality.
2. Adjusting for room acoustics: Another benefit of having an equalizer in a Bluetooth party speaker is the ability to adjust the sound output to match the acoustics of the room. Different rooms have different acoustics, and the equalizer allows you to adjust the sound to optimize it for the specific room you are in. This ensures that the sound is balanced and consistent, regardless of the room you are in.
3. Enhancing bass response: Many people enjoy listening to music with a heavy bass, and the equalizer allows you to enhance the bass response of the speaker. This creates a more dynamic and engaging listening experience, particularly when listening to genres such as hip hop, EDM, or rock music.
4. Reducing distortion: Sometimes, the sound output of a speaker can become distorted when the volume is turned up too high. An equalizer can help reduce distortion by allowing you to adjust the sound to optimize it for the specific volume level you are listening at. This ensures that the sound remains clear and undistorted, even at high volumes.
5. Fine-tuning for different sources: Finally, an equalizer allows you to fine-tune the sound output for different sources of music. Whether you are streaming music from Spotify, playing music from a USB drive, or using a DJ controller, the equalizer allows you to adjust the sound to optimize it for the specific source of music you are using.
In summary, the benefits of having an equalizer in a Bluetooth party speaker include the ability to customize the sound output, adjust for room acoustics, enhance bass response, reduce distortion, and fine-tune the sound for different sources of music. These benefits enhance the overall listening experience and make Bluetooth party speakers with equalizer an excellent choice for music lovers.
